Provides ServicesProvides Advocacy/advice/informationCharitable objects
4 THE FOLLOWING CHARITY'S OBJECTS ("OBJECTS") ARE SPECIFICALLY RESTRICTED TO THE FOLLOWING (IN ORDER OF PREFERENCE);A) TO ADVANCE THE HEALTH AND FURTHER THE EDUCATION OF EX-SERVICE MEN AND WOMEN AND/OR INJURED ARMED FORCES PERSONNEL IN THE UK WHO HAVE BEEN INJURED OR HAVE PHYSICAL AND/OR MENTAL HEALTH NEEDS AND/OR ARE IN FINANCIAL NEED(1) BY THE PROVISION, MAINTENANCE AND IMPROVEMENT OF HOLIDAY ACCOMMODATION FOR THEMSELVES, THEIR SPOUSES OR PARTNERS, CHILDREN AND CARERS; AND(2) IN FURTHERANCE OF THESE AIMS PROVISIONS WILL ALSO INCLUDE A MENTORING, COACHING AND COUNSELLING SERVICE FOR THE BENEFIT OF EX-SERVICE MEN AND WOMEN AND ARMED FORCES PERSONNEL AND THEIR SPOUSES, PARTNERS AND FAMILIES; AND(3) TRAINING, COACHING AND MENTORING FOR THE RELIEF OF UNEMPLOYMENT TO ENABLE THE BENEFICIARIES TO GAIN WORK AND EMPLOYMENT IN SUCH WAYS AS MAY BE THOUGHT FIT. B) TO ADVANCE THE HEALTH AND FURTHER EDUCATION OF THOSE IN CHESHIRE, MERSEYSIDE AND GREATER MANCHESTER IN NEED BY REASON OF ILL HEALTH, DISABILITY, FINANCIAL HARDSHIP OR OTHER DISADVANTAGE (1) IN FURTHERANCE OF THESE AIMS PROVISIONS WILL ALSO INCLUDE A MENTORING, COACHING AND COUNSELLING SERVICE AS WELL AS TRAINING AND MENTORING TO ENABLE THE BENEFICIARIES TO GAIN EMPLOYMENT.
